Tibet - Journey to Mount Kailas (21 days)
Mount Kailas is said to be the mythical Mount Mera, the centre of the universe. It is revered in both Hindu and Buddhist legends, while its location, close to the sources of the four main rivers that flow across the Indian sub-continent, contributes to its mystique. Our adventure includes a week long journey from Lhasa (via Gyantse and Shigatse) across the vast Tibetan plateau. We plan to reach Mount Kailas at the time of the Saga Dawa festival when many thousands of pilgrims from throughout Tibet gather to pay homage to the mountain. After the festive celebrations we will undertake a three day trek around Mount Kailas before a final nights camp alongside the shores of Lake Manasarovar.
- DAY 1: Join Kathmandu
- DAY 2: In Kathmandu, sightseeing Kathmandu Valley
- DAY 3: Fly Kathmandu to Lhasa
- DAYS 4/5: In Lhasa, visit the historic Potala Palace, the Norbulingka and the ancient Jokhang
- DAY 6: Drive to Gyantse with its historic fort and Kumbum
- DAY 7: Drive to Shigatse visit the Tashilhunpo
- DAYS 8/11: Rugged drive across Tibetan Plateau to Mt Kailas
- DAY 12: At Mt Kailas
- DAYS 13/15: Celebrate Saga Dawa festival, commence trek around Mt Kailas to Lake Manasarovar
- DAYS 16/19: Drive beneath Himalayan range to San Kosi Gorge, descend to Zhangmu
- DAY 20: Transfer to Kathmandu
- DAY 21: In Kathmandu, trip concludes
